But this doesn't necessarily mean that online brokers do not charge any fees. They charge prices of varying rates for a variety of services to make money. There are mainly three types of fees for this purpose.
The first sort of charges to keep an eye out for are trading charges. Whenever you make an actual trade, like buying a stock or an ETF, you are billed trading charges. In these instances, you are paying a spread, financing rate, or even a commission. The sorts of trading fees and the prices vary from broker to broker.
Commissions can be fixed or determined by the traded quantity. On the flip side, a spread refers to the gap between the buying and selling price. Financing or overnight rates are those that are billed when you maintain a leveraged position for more than a day.
Apart from trading fees, online brokers also charge non-trading fees. These are determined by the actions you undertake on your account. They are charged for operations like depositing cash, not trading for long periods, or withdrawals.
